Changing over press. Removing end of steel coil

Employee attempted to throw a piece of steel coil through a gap in equipment into scrap hopper. The piece of steel coil bounced back into arm.

Laceration to right arm.

End of steel coil

Employee picked up the end of steel coil and carried it towards a scrap hopper where they attempted to throw it through a gap in equipment to the hopper. The coil end bounced back into their arm resulting an a laceration. Object Substance: steel coil e
